Release Date: February 6th, 2009 (wide)

Starring: Sam Huntington, Christopher Marquette, Dan Fogler, Jay Baruchel, Kristen Bell
 
Directed by: Kyle Newman 

Premise: Four extreme "Star Wars" fans and childhood friends drive across America to Skywalker Ranch in order to sneak a peek at the yet unreleased "Episode 1: Phantom Menace" as one last hoorah for their dying friend.
